In a bold move that has sent shockwaves through the technology sector, Oracle has announced a major reduction in its workforce. The tech giant is eliminating 21,000 positions, representing approximately 13% of its total global workforce. This drastic decision raises critical questions about the future of employment in the tech industry, especially as companies increasingly turn to artificial intelligence (AI) to streamline operations and reduce costs.

How AI is Transforming Job Roles

AI is reshaping job roles across various sectors. In the case of Oracle, the integration of AI is intended to enhance productivity and optimize workflows. However, this raises concerns about job security for many employees. Here are some key areas where AI is making an impact:

  • Data Analysis: AI systems can process vast amounts of data faster than human analysts, leading to quicker decision-making.
  • Customer Service: AI chatbots are increasingly taking over customer support roles, providing 24/7 assistance with minimal human intervention.
  • Software Development: AI tools are being used to automate coding, testing, and maintenance processes, making development faster and more efficient.

Emerging Opportunities in AI

Despite the concerning news of job cuts, the rise of AI also presents new opportunities. Here are some areas where job seekers can focus their efforts:

  • AI Development: With the growing demand for AI solutions, professionals skilled in AI programming and machine learning are in high demand.
  • Data Science: As companies rely on data-driven decisions, data scientists who can interpret and analyze data will continue to be sought after.
  • Cybersecurity: As more companies adopt AI, the need for cybersecurity experts to protect sensitive data will increase.
